修复列表报错

This commit is contained in:
liaozetao
2024-04-12 18:10:32 +08:00
parent 4ffe60e391
commit 7df38eca31
6 changed files with 103 additions and 37 deletions

View File

@@ -587,7 +587,10 @@ export default {
console.log(res); console.log(res);
request.success({ request.success({
"rows": res.rows.map(i=>{ "rows": res.rows.map(i=>{
i.name = JSON.parse(i.name); let value = i.name;
if (value.startsWith('{') && value.endsWith('}')) {
i.name = JSON.parse(value);
}
return i; return i;
}), }),
"total": res.total "total": res.total
@@ -849,10 +852,17 @@ export default {
// $("#renewPrice").val(json.entity.renewPrice); // $("#renewPrice").val(json.entity.renewPrice);
$("#days").val(json.entity.days); $("#days").val(json.entity.days);
console.log(json.entity.name) console.log(json.entity.name)
var jsonName = JSON.parse(json.entity.name); let name = json.entity.name;
$("#name").val(jsonName.zh); if (name.startsWith('{') && name.endsWith('}')) {
$("#ar_name").val(jsonName.ar); var jsonName = JSON.parse(json.entity.name);
$("#en_name").val(jsonName.en); $("#name").val(jsonName.zh);
$("#ar_name").val(jsonName.ar);
$("#en_name").val(jsonName.en);
} else {
$("#name").val(name);
$("#ar_name").val(name);
$("#en_name").val(name);
}
$("#price").val(json.entity.price); $("#price").val(json.entity.price);
$("#renewPrice").val(json.entity.renewPrice); $("#renewPrice").val(json.entity.renewPrice);
$("#seq").val(json.entity.seq); $("#seq").val(json.entity.seq);

View File

@@ -324,7 +324,10 @@ export default {
console.log(res); console.log(res);
request.success({ request.success({
"rows": res.rows.map(i=>{ "rows": res.rows.map(i=>{
i.name = JSON.parse(i.name); let value = i.name;
if (value.startsWith('{') && value.endsWith('}')) {
i.name = JSON.parse(value);
}
return i; return i;
}), }),
"total": res.total "total": res.total
@@ -358,11 +361,20 @@ export default {
$("#addForm #modal_id").val(row.id); $("#addForm #modal_id").val(row.id);
$("#addForm #modal_type").val(row.type); $("#addForm #modal_type").val(row.type);
console.log(row.name) console.log(row.name)
$("#modal_name").val(row.name.zh); let name = row.name;
// 阿语名称 if (name.startsWith('{') && name.endsWith('}')) {
$("#ar_modal_name").val(row.name.ar); $("#modal_name").val(row.name.zh);
// 语名称 // 语名称
$("#en_modal_name").val(row.name.en); $("#ar_modal_name").val(row.name.ar);
// 英语名称
$("#en_modal_name").val(row.name.en);
} else {
$("#modal_name").val(name);
// 阿语名称
$("#ar_modal_name").val(name);
// 英语名称
$("#en_modal_name").val(name);
}
$('#addAndroidIconPicUrl').attr("src", row.androidUrl); $('#addAndroidIconPicUrl').attr("src", row.androidUrl);
$("#addForm #androidUrl").val(row.androidUrl); $("#addForm #androidUrl").val(row.androidUrl);
$('#addIosIconPicUrl').attr("src", row.iosUrl); $('#addIosIconPicUrl').attr("src", row.iosUrl);

View File

@@ -594,7 +594,10 @@ export default {
console.log(res); console.log(res);
request.success({ request.success({
"rows": res.rows.map(i=>{ "rows": res.rows.map(i=>{
i.name = JSON.parse(i.name); let value = i.name;
if (value.startsWith('{') && value.endsWith('}')) {
i.name = JSON.parse(value);
}
return i; return i;
}), }),
"total": res.total "total": res.total
@@ -797,11 +800,18 @@ export default {
//$("#name").attr('readonly', true); //$("#name").attr('readonly', true);
//$("#price").attr('readonly', true); //$("#price").attr('readonly', true);
//$("#renewPrice").attr('readonly', true); //$("#renewPrice").attr('readonly', true);
let name = json.name;
var jsonName = JSON.parse(json.name); if (name.startsWith('{') && name.endsWith('}')) {
$("#headwearName").val(jsonName.zh); var jsonName = JSON.parse(json.name);
$("#headwearArName").val(jsonName.ar); $("#headwearName").val(jsonName.zh);
$("#headwearEnName").val(jsonName.en); $("#headwearArName").val(jsonName.ar);
$("#headwearEnName").val(jsonName.en);
} else {
$("#headwearName").val(name);
$("#headwearArName").val(name);
$("#headwearEnName").val(name);
}
$("#price").val(json.price); $("#price").val(json.price);
$("#renewPrice").val(json.renewPrice); $("#renewPrice").val(json.renewPrice);
$("#limitDesc").val(json.limitDesc); $("#limitDesc").val(json.limitDesc);

View File

@@ -312,7 +312,10 @@ export default {
console.log(res); console.log(res);
request.success({ request.success({
"rows": res.rows.map(i=>{ "rows": res.rows.map(i=>{
i.name = JSON.parse(i.name); let value = i.name;
if (value.startsWith('{') && value.endsWith('}')) {
i.name = JSON.parse(value);
}
return i; return i;
}), }),
"total": res.total "total": res.total
@@ -345,11 +348,20 @@ export default {
// 赋值 // 赋值
$("#addForm #modal_id").val(row.id); $("#addForm #modal_id").val(row.id);
$("#addForm #modal_type").val(row.type); $("#addForm #modal_type").val(row.type);
$("#addForm #modal_name").val(row.name.zh); let name = row.name;
// 阿语 if (name && Object.prototype.hasOwnProperty.call(name, 'zh') && Object.prototype.hasOwnProperty.call(name, 'ar') && Object.prototype.hasOwnProperty.call(name, 'en')) {
$("#addForm #ar_modal_name").val(row.name.ar); $("#addForm #modal_name").val(row.name.zh);
// //
$("#addForm #en_modal_name").val(row.name.en); $("#addForm #ar_modal_name").val(row.name.ar);
// 英语
$("#addForm #en_modal_name").val(row.name.en);
} else {
$("#addForm #modal_name").val(name);
// 阿语
$("#addForm #ar_modal_name").val(name);
// 英语
$("#addForm #en_modal_name").val(name);
}
$('#addIconPicUrl').attr("src", row.pic); $('#addIconPicUrl').attr("src", row.pic);
$("#addForm #pic").val(row.pic); $("#addForm #pic").val(row.pic);
$("#addForm #status").val(row.status); $("#addForm #status").val(row.status);

View File

@@ -350,7 +350,10 @@ export default {
console.log(res); console.log(res);
request.success({ request.success({
"rows": res.rows.map(i=>{ "rows": res.rows.map(i=>{
i.name = JSON.parse(i.name); let value = i.name;
if (value.startsWith('{') && value.endsWith('}')) {
i.name = JSON.parse(i.name);
}
return i; return i;
}), }),
"total": res.total "total": res.total
@@ -388,11 +391,19 @@ export default {
if (json) { if (json) {
$("#id").val(json.id); $("#id").val(json.id);
$("#nameplateType1").val(json.nameplateType); $("#nameplateType1").val(json.nameplateType);
var jsonName = JSON.parse(json.name); let name = json.name;
console.log(jsonName) if (name.startsWith('{') && name.endsWith('}')) {
$("#name1").val(jsonName.zh); var jsonName = JSON.parse(json.name);
$("#ar_name1").val(jsonName.ar); console.log(jsonName)
$("#en_name1").val(jsonName.en); $("#name1").val(jsonName.zh);
$("#ar_name1").val(jsonName.ar);
$("#en_name1").val(jsonName.en);
} else {
$("#name1").val(name);
$("#ar_name1").val(name);
$("#en_name1").val(name);
}
$('#nameplateType1').attr("disabled", "true"); $('#nameplateType1').attr("disabled", "true");
if (json.isCustomWord == 0) { if (json.isCustomWord == 0) {
$('input[name="isCustomWord"]').get(0).checked = true; $('input[name="isCustomWord"]').get(0).checked = true;

View File

@@ -843,7 +843,10 @@ export default {
console.log(res); console.log(res);
request.success({ request.success({
"rows": res.rows.map(i=>{ "rows": res.rows.map(i=>{
i.giftName = JSON.parse(i.giftName); let value = i.giftName;
if (value.startsWith('{') && value.endsWith('}')) {
i.giftName = JSON.parse(value);
}
return i; return i;
}), }),
"total": res.total "total": res.total
@@ -1216,13 +1219,21 @@ export default {
} }
if (json.entity) { if (json.entity) {
$("#giftId").val(json.entity.giftId); $("#giftId").val(json.entity.giftId);
let giftName = json.entity.giftName;
var jsonName = JSON.parse(json.entity.giftName); if (giftName.startsWith('{') && giftName.endsWith('}')) {
$("#giftName").val(jsonName.zh); var jsonName = JSON.parse(giftName);
// 阿语名称 $("#giftName").val(jsonName.zh);
$("#giftArName").val(jsonName.ar); // 阿语名称
// 英语名称 $("#giftArName").val(jsonName.ar);
$("#giftEnName").val(jsonName.en); // 英语名称
$("#giftEnName").val(jsonName.en);
} else {
$("#giftName").val(giftName);
// 阿语名称
$("#giftArName").val(giftName);
// 英语名称
$("#giftEnName").val(giftName);
}
$("#goldPrice").val(json.entity.goldPrice); $("#goldPrice").val(json.entity.goldPrice);
$("#seqNo").val(json.entity.seqNo); $("#seqNo").val(json.entity.seqNo);